Output 16860e891ee68a539011e7a7b81bdfd5ca3081e5cc8e33766a1ae54f622e863f:1

value
40076236
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e6d8b7c0318fdeef07dd77d1622f67a6a64d8331 OP_EQUAL
address
3NjcxUnRGkA2JdsbuahjAx1qz22GWiYvYw
transaction
16860e891ee68a539011e7a7b81bdfd5ca3081e5cc8e33766a1ae54f622e863f
spent
true